Abstract

A radiological image-capturing device includes: a first read control section that executes a first read mode in which electric signals stored in a plurality of pixels are read out simultaneously in units of a plurality of rows; and an emission-start determining section that determines that the emission of radiation from a radiation source onto an image-capturing panel has started when the values of the electric signals read by the first read control section have become greater than an arbitrarily settable threshold. If it is determined by the emission-start determining section that the emission of the radiation has started, the first read control section terminates the reading of the electric signals, and thereby brings the image-capturing panel into an exposure state.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A radiographic image capturing apparatus comprising:
 an image capturing panel containing a plurality of pixels arranged in a matrix for converting a radiation, which is emitted from a radiation source and transmitted through a subject, into electric signals and storing the electric signals,   a first readout control part for executing a first readout mode for reading the electric signals stored in the pixels based on an image capturing menu concerning irradiation of the radiation;   a mode transition judgment part for judging start of the first readout mode; and   a first announcement device for announcing a judgment result of the mode transition judgment part to the outside in a case where the mode transition part judges that the first readout mode is started.   
     
     
         2 . The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first readout control part reads the electric signals stored in the pixels in a plurality of rows simultaneously or the electric signals stored in predetermined rows of pixels simultaneously. 
     
     
         3 . The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ising a irradiation start judgment part for judging that emission of the radiation from the radiation source to the image capturing panel is started, and instructing the first readout control part to stop reading of the electric signals and to switch the image capturing panel to an exposure state, in a case where a value of the electric signals read by the first readout control part becomes larger than an arbitrarily given threshold value. 
     
     
         4 . The radiographic image captur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the first announcement part includes at least one of a sound output device for outputting a sound indicating the judgment result, a light output device for outputting a light indicating the judgment result, and a first communication device for sending a communication signal indicating the judgment result to the outside. 
     
     
         5 . A radiographic image capturing system comprising the radiographic image capturing apparatus according to  claim 4 , the system comprising:
 a table for storing image capturing conditions including at least irradiation times of the radiation;   an image capturing menu setting unit for setting the image capturing menu based on the image capturing conditions;   a second communication device for sending the image capturing menu to the first communication device and receiving the communication signal from the first communication device; and   a second announcement device for announcing start of the first readout mode based on the communication signal.   
     
     
         6 . The radiographic image capturing system according to  claim 5 , further comprising
 an input device for selecting, by a user, image capturing conditions corresponding to an image area of the subject from the image capturing conditions stored in the table,   wherein   the image capturing menu setting unit sets an image capturing menu including the image capturing conditions selected by an input operation of the user,   the second communication device sends the image capturing menu set by the image capturing menu setting unit to the first communication device,   the first readout control part executes the first readout mode based on the image capturing menu in a case where the first communication device receives the image capturing menu.   
     
     
         7 . The radiographic image capturing system according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the radiographic image capturing apparatus further comprises:
 a second readout control part for executing a second readout mode for reading the electric signals stored in the pixels sequentially row by row; and 
 an imaging control device for controlling the first readout control part to start the first readout mode or controlling the second the first and second readout control parts to switch from the second readout mode to the first readout mode in a case where the first communication device receives the image capturing menu. 
   
     
     
         8 . The radiographic image capturing system according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the second readout control part, performing the second readout mode before the first readout mode is performed by the first readout control part, reads the electric signals stored in the pixels as offset signals sequentially row by row, or performs a reset operation for discharging the electric signals stored in the pixels to the ground.   
     
     
         9 . The radiographic image capturing system according to  claim 5 , wherein
 the second announcement device includes at least one of a displaying unit for displaying an image indicating start of the first readout mode, a sound output device for outputting sound indicating the start of the first readout mode, and a light output device for emitting light indicating the start of the first readout mode.   
     
     
         10 . The radiographic image capturing system according to  claim 5 , further comprising:
 the radiation source; and   a radiation switch for emitting the radiation from the radiation source in response to an operation of the radiation switch by a user,   wherein the operation of the radiation switch by the user is allowed by an announcement from the first announcement device and/or the second announcement device.   
     
     
         11 . A method for capturing a radiographic image, performed using a computer equipped with an image capturing panel, wherein the image capturing panel contains a plurality of pixels arranged in a matrix for converting a radiation, which is emitted from a radiation source and transmitted through a subject, into electric signals and storing the electric signals, the method comprising:
 executing a first readout mode for reading the electric signals stored in the pixels based on an image capturing menu concerning irradiation of the radiation;   judging start of the first readout mode; and   announcing to the outside a judgment result of judging the start of the first readout mode.   
     
     
         12 . A non-transitory recording medium storing a program, the program causing a computer equipped with an image capturing panel, wherein the image capturing panel contains a plurality of pixels arranged in a matrix for converting a radiation, which is emitted from a radiation source and transmitted through a subject, into electric signals and storing the electric signals, to function as:
 a first readout control part for executing a first readout mode for reading the electric signals stored in the pixels based on an image capturing menu concerning irradiation of the radiation;   a mode transition judgment part for judging start of the first readout mode; and   a first announcement device for announcing a judgment result of the mode transition judgment part to the outside in a case where the mode transition part judges that the first readout mode is started.   
     
     
         13 . A method for capturing a radiographic image, performed using a computer equipped with an image capturing panel, wherein the image capturing panel contains a plurality of pixels arranged in a matrix for converting a radiation, which is emitted from a radiation source and transmitted through a subject, into electric signals and storing the electric signals, the method comprising:
 executing a first readout mode for reading the electric signals stored in the pixels;   judging start of the first readout mode; and   announcing to the outside a judgment result of judging the start of the first readout mode.
